| I'm looking at a deer rifle for my wife, a friend has one that he says is a full custom 308. It has no markings on it but 308. Who would make something like this and what is it worth? |
That's a pretty hard question to answer, without knowing anything about the rifle other than being chambered for .308 Win! Without pictures there are a couple things that would help, however.
#1 what action is it made on?
#2 what kind of stock, wood or synthetic?
#3 What kind of sights are on he barrel?
#4 is it drilled and tapped for a scope? If so ......
#5 what kind of scope is on the rifle?, and what kind of mount?
A full custom simply means someone made it to order for someone! The prices can go from not worth as much as a fence post, to a $10K masterpiece.
The best thing you can do is post a few pictures of the rifle from all angles to show what you have, otherwise It is imposible to tell you anything with the info we have so far!
